Earnings for Psychology Graduates from University of Northern Iowa

Graduates of University of Northern Iowa’s Psychology program earn the following amounts (per the U.S. Department of Education’s College Scorecard):

Median earnings by years after graduation for Psychology at University of Northern Iowa
Years After Graduation Median Earnings
1 year $29,766
2 years $33,500
3 years $39,986
4 years $46,406
5 years $51,022

Is this above or below average for the school? Four years out, Psychology graduates from University of Northern Iowa report median earnings of $46,406, compared with $50,993 for all University of Northern Iowa graduates — about 9% lower than the school-wide median.

Median Debt at Graduation

Median student loan debt for Psychology graduates from University of Northern Iowa is $22,500.
